    Why are prefabricated houses so popular?

  • 8/18/2019 Prefabricated housing in Japan

    6/25

    ○ could be tear down easily

    ○ a prefabricated house means a disposal goods in Japan

    several reasons:

    ○ a long cultural isolation caused an urgent need to stay modern

    ○ shinto belief of previous resident’s spirit in the property

    ○ revisioning of building codes after every significant earthquake

    What is the future of a prefabricated housing?

  • 8/18/2019 Prefabricated housing in Japan

    24/25

    ○ production is generally declining

    ○ house manufacturers are more focusing on renovations

    ○ Japanese government creates plans to support sustainablearchitecture and prolong an average lifespan of building
